Laughter Lightens The Load

Laughter is the best medicine, especially when the illness is stress-related.  If you can't find another solution to a stressful problem, consider finding the humor in it.

Constant stress from any cause takes a toll on you.  Physical illness such as headaches, digestive problems and heart disease are linked to chronic stress.  You are familiar with the emotional cost of too much stress – life is simply no fun.

But you have many weapons against stress.  Here are just a few:

  • Do something about whatever is worrying you.  If the problem is related to work, come up with a solution and discuss it with your supervisor.
  • If you can't fix the problem, make up your mind to just live with it.  Accepting something, even if you don't like it, relieves stress.
  • Use your time well.  Do not take on more commitments than you can handle.  Direct your efforts to the things that really matter.

And remember to laugh.  Laugh a lot.  Laugh out loud.  Laughter actually creates chemical changes in your body that cause you to relax and feel better.
